11.6.18 ULRCVEXCNT: Ultra Receive Extra Word Count Register (XDATA at F0F9)
76543210
RSV RSV RSV RSV WORDCN3 WORDCN2 WORDCN1 WORDCN0
R/O R/O R/O R/O R/O R/O R/O R/O
BIT
NAME RESET FUNCTION
3−0 WORDCN[3:0] 0h Ultra receive extra word count.
The value in this register indicates the word count of the extra number of words received
between the TUSB6250 pausing and terminating a UDMA read transfer after the expected
byte count is received. Based on the ATA/ATAPI-5 specification, the ATA/ATAPI device may
send 1, 2, or 3 words (up to 6 bytes) of data after the host pauses the UDMA read transfer.
Although it should not happen, in case WORDCN[3:0] returns 0Fh (15 words) for read, it only
means the TUSB6250 receives at least 15 words, because the counter stops counting after
reaching 0Fh, which is maintained.
The WORDCN[3:0] bits are cleared whenever the MCU sets START_ATAPI or SOFT_RST
in the ATPIFCNFG1 register.
7−4 RSV 0h Reserved
